WBSSC Group C & D Recruitment NotificationThe West Bengal School Service Commission (WBSSC) has released the official notification for the 1st State Level Selection Test (SLST) 2025, announcing 8477 vacancies for non-teaching staff under Group C (Clerk, Librarian) and Group D (Peon, Laboratory Attendant, Night Guard, etc.) in government-aided and sponsored schools across West Bengal. This recruitment drive, the first in seven years, offers a golden opportunity for job seekers to secure stable government jobs. Applications are open from 16th September to 31st October 2025 via the official website, www.westbengalssc.com.

WBSSC Group C & D Eligibility CriteriaTo apply for WBSSC Group C and D Recruitment 2025, candidates must meet the following eligibility requirements:
- Citizenship: Must be a citizen of India.
- Conduct: Candidates dismissed from service or convicted by a court of law are ineligible.
- Language Proficiency: Proficiency in reading, writing, and speaking Bengali is mandatory for Group D posts.
WBSSC Group C & D Educational QualificationThe educational qualifications vary by post:
Post |
Minimum Qualification |
Clerk (Group C) |
Passed Madhyamik (Class 10) or equivalent from a
recognized board. |
Librarian (Group C) |
Bachelor’s Degree in any stream (Arts/Science/ Commerce)
from a UGC-recognized university + Bachelor’s Degree in Library Science. |
Group D |
Studied up to Class VIII or higher from a
recognized school. |
Note: Certificates for SC/ST/OBC/PH must be issued by competent West Bengal authorities before the application deadline.
WBSSC Group C & D Age Limit
- Clerk and Group D: Minimum 18 years, maximum 40 years as of 1st January 2025.
- Librarian: Minimum 20 years, maximum 40 years as of 1st January 2025.
- Age Relaxation:
- SC/ST: 5 years
- OBC: 3 years
- Physically Handicapped (PH): 8 years
- Candidates from other states are treated as General candidates with no relaxation.
WBSSC Group C & D Pay Scale and BenefitsSelected candidates will receive competitive salaries along with allowances as per West Bengal government norms:
- Group C (Clerk): In-hand salary ranges from Rs. 26,405 to Rs. 29,955/month.
- Group D: In-hand salary starts at Rs. 20,050/month (basic pay: Rs. 17,700 + HRA, DA, Medical Allowances).
- Additional Benefits: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), medical benefits, and pension schemes as per government rules.

WBSSC Group C & D Selection ProcessThe selection process for WBSSC Group C and D Recruitment 2025 includes:
- Written Examination: Objective-type (MCQ) test.
- Skill/Proficiency Test (for Clerk): Computer typing and proficiency test (15 marks out of 25 for the interview).
- Interview: Evaluation of qualifications, experience, and personality test.
- Document Verification: Verification of educational and other certificates.
WBSSC Group C & D Exam Pattern and SyllabusExam Pattern
- Group C (Clerk, Librarian):
- Subjects: General Knowledge, Current Affairs, General English, Arithmetic.
- Questions: 60 MCQs.
- Duration: 1 hour.
- Marking: 1 mark per question; negative marking may apply (to be confirmed in the detailed notification).
- Group D:
- Subjects: General Knowledge, Current Affairs, Arithmetic.
- Questions: 45 MCQs.
- Duration: 1 hour.
- Marking: 1 mark per question; negative marking may apply.
- General Knowledge: Indian history, geography, polity, and culture.
- Current Affairs: National and international events, sports, awards.
- General English: Grammar, vocabulary, comprehension, sentence structure.
- Arithmetic: Basic operations, percentages, ratios, averages, simple interest.

Place of PostingSelected candidates will be posted in government-aided and sponsored schools across West Bengal, excluding hill regions. Specific postings will depend on vacancies and candidate preferences during counseling.
